Yet another essential characteristic of house music is its extensive utilization of samples. House music producers normally borrow snippets from other tunes—be it a catchy hook, a soulful vocal line, or perhaps a funk-infused bassline—and repurpose them inside of their tracks.

Chicago Mayor Richard M. Daley proclaimed 10 August 2005, to generally be "House Unity Day" in Chicago, in celebration from the "21st anniversary of house music" (truly the twenty first anniversary of your founding of Trax Documents, an independent Chicago-centered house label). The proclamation acknowledged Chicago as the original residence of house music and the music's first creators "were being encouraged via the enjoy of their town, Together with the dream that sometime their music would distribute a message of peace and unity all through the environment".

Starting in 1985 and 1986, more and more Chicago DJs commenced manufacturing and releasing original compositions. These compositions applied freshly very affordable electronic instruments and Increased models of disco and also other dance music they previously favored.
Certainly one of the primary things in house dancing is "the jack" or "jacking" — a design designed during the early days of Chicago house that still left its trace in many record titles for instance "Time for you to Jack" by Chip E.
The house music dance scene was Probably the most built-in and progressive spaces from the nineteen eighties; the black and gay populations, along with other minority groups, have been capable to dance alongside one another in a very favourable natural environment.[47]
